How Attorneys Partner with Oasis
Oasis partners with law firms and individual attorneys committed to supporting our LGBTQ+ immigrant community. Pro bono attorneys help in many ways, including:
Legal Research
Limited-Scope Projects
Full-Scope Representation
No Prior Immigration Experience Needed
Attorneys do not need immigration law experience to volunteer. Our staff attorneys provide robust training and mentorship, and many volunteers find that working with Oasis clients is among the most meaningful experiences of their legal careers.
Time Commitment
Pro bono opportunities generally take place between Monday to Friday, 9:00 AM – 5:00 PM (PST).
Oasis offers a range of volunteer opportunities for individuals who can commit to at least 2 hours per week for 3 months. Below are ways you can share your time and talents.

Interpretation & Translation
Oasis regularly uses volunteers for written and oral translations (all languages are welcome, with a high need for Spanish and Portuguese).
2+ Hours Per Week / 3 Months
Administrative Support
We rely on committed administrative volunteers to help with tasks such as filing, data entry, and other data analysis projects.
2+ Hours Per Week / 3 Months
Communications
Volunteers with experience in graphic design, photography, and copy editing have opportunities to support Oasis’ communications team.
Flexible / Project-Based
Fundraising & Events
Volunteers are key to the success of Oasis’ fundraising, from helping with events to doing grant research and writing, donor appreciation initiatives, in-kind donation outreach, and more.
As Needed
Psychological Evaluations
Oasis works with psychologists and MFTs who provide psychological evaluations for LGBTQ+ asylum seekers. An orientation is provided. Volunteers must commit to at least five pro bono evaluations a year.
5 Evaluations / Year
